Solution
"Liquids are able to flow" matches with "because the particles have enough energy stored to move past each other."
"Gases can be compressed" matches with "because the particles are, on average, far apart so there is space for particles to be pushed closer together."
"Solids have a fixed shape" matches with "because the particles only store enough energy to vibrate around a fixed position."
